On some levels of Jetbook firmware, the meta data of PDF files is displayed in the book list, not the name of the file. (On level 35m, the meta data is no longer displayed.)

I don't know what the JBL does with PDF meta data, but that may be the situation you have. If so, you can use a PDF meta data editor to change it.
Yup, that was what it was. I went to Preferences in Adobe Acrobat, deleted the title and author, and closed the file. After that, the filename showed up as the book title. Thanks for the tip.
